Chinese lantern festival opens in Serbian capital

I want prosperity for China and Serbia for the new year, says Chinese ambassador

By Talha Ozturk

BELGRADE, Serbia (AA) - Serbia joined the celebration of the Chinese New Year on Monday.

The Lantern Festival or Chinese Festival of Light marking final day of the traditional Chinese New Year Spring Festival period was opened in the capital Belgrade for the first time.

The festival at the Kalemegran Fortress in the center of the city where visitors can enjoy the China light calais is organized for the Chinese New Year until Feb. 24.

Speaking at the opening of the festival, Serbian Prime Minister Ana Brnabic said that Serbia and China have a "contemporary steel friendship.

"With the desire to bring progress, wealth and success to the year, I invite all citizens to visit this exhibition until Feb. 24 and enjoy meeting Chinese culture," Brnabic said. "Happy New Year."

China's Ambassador to Serbia, Chen Bo, said in the Serbian language China's New Year is the most important day of the year. The time of joy and family gathering, assessing that China and Serbia are geographically distant, but that the hearts of the people of the two countries are closely linked.

"This year, according to the Chinese calendar, is a year of golden pig, which is a symbol of happiness and wealth. I want prosperity for China and Serbia," said Bo.

After the speeches the festival officially kicked off with fireworks.

Zigong Haitian, Panda, Ancient Age, Wonderful Deer and Shapath Penguin are among the objects exhibited in the festival.

Entrance to the festival is free.

Laterns are made of concrete blocks and iron, sculpted with vibrant hand painted fabric and lit with led lights in the shapes of animals and other designs to reflect the tradition of the festival and spirit of the zoo.

The lantern festival dates back more than 2,000 years to the Han dynasty. The tradition is a festival to celebrate family reunion and happiness.
